Showing posts with the label jdk

VS Code 프로젝트별 JDK 버전 분리 및 자동화 설정

현 업에서 마이크로서비스 아키텍처(MSA)로의 전환이나 레거시 시스템의 유지보수를 병행하다 보면, 단일 로컬 머신에서 다양한 자바(Java) 버전을 구동해야 하는 상황에 직면합니다. 예를 들어, 결제 모듈은 안정성을 이유로 Java 8 기반의 레거시 코드를 유지하고, 신규 검색 서비스는 Spring Boot 3.x 기반의 Java 17 혹은 21을 요구…
VS Code 프로젝트별 JDK 버전 분리 및 자동화 설정

맥에서 자바 버전 자유롭게 넘나들기

macOS에서 자바 개발을 시작하는 여정은 종종 'JAVA_HOME'이라는 보이지 않는 벽 앞에서 좌절감으로 시작되곤 합니다. 빌드가 이유 없이 실패하고, 로컬 서버는 꿈쩍도 하지 않으며, 애써 설치한 최신 IDE는 JDK를 찾지 못해 방황하는 상황. 인터넷을 헤매며 찾아낸 수많은 가이드는 단편적인 명령어 조각들만 던져줄 뿐, 왜 그 명령…
맥에서 자바 버전 자유롭게 넘나들기
OlderHomeNewest